Transaction 9c94838579393ccf03433818605670c3048a8135e486b95f9581ace691c6ec68
1 Input
1 Output
-
9c94838579393ccf03433818605670c3048a8135e486b95f9581ace691c6ec68:0
- value
- 11535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c489b67ebfa5155a794b19b2244d3659d3050b7 OP_EQUAL
- address
- 37BmSt18UroAjworqBR3jyViCY2U7nqhVS